Roasted Brussels Sprouts Honey (Printable)

Crisp Brussels sprouts roasted and glazed with honey for a sweet-savory side.

# What You Need:

→ Vegetables

01 - 1 lb Brussels sprouts, trimmed and halved

→ Oils & Seasonings

02 - 2 tbsp olive oil
03 - ½ tsp sea salt
04 - ¼ tsp freshly ground black pepper

→ Finishing

05 - 2 tbsp honey
06 - ½ tbsp balsamic vinegar (optional)

# Steps:

01 - Preheat the oven to 425°F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
02 - In a large bowl, toss the Brussels sprouts with olive oil, salt, and pepper until evenly coated.
03 - Spread the Brussels sprouts in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et, cut side down for optimal caramelization.
04 - Roast for 20–25 minutes, stirring halfway, until golden brown and crispy on the edges.
05 - Remove from the oven. Drizzle immediately with honey and balsamic vinegar (if using), and toss to coat evenly. Serve hot as a side dish.

02 -
  • Crowding the pan is the enemy of crispy sprouts so give them room to breathe
  • The honey drizzle happens AFTER roasting not before or it will burn
03 -
  • Buy sprouts that feel heavy and tight with bright green leaves
  • Let the pan get hot again between batches if you are making extra
